Education for NGOs

Helping you know your rights and use them wisely.


Many 501c3 nonprofit organizations operate believing they are not allowed to advocate for legislation. This simply is not true. These groups are allowed to meet with legislators to educate them about different bills as much as they would like. When it comes to asking politicians to vote one way or another on legislation, most 501c3 organizations are allowed to lobby. Click here for more info on 501(c)(3) lobbying rules.


We know the laws around advocacy can be confusing, and because of that, most groups "play it safe" and do not utilize their full rights to lobby. We want to help simplify and demystify these rules so that both nonprofits and small businesses exercise their abilities to influence the laws that affect us all.
